ttcn3-hnbgw: sed junit file in the clean_up trap
Same as done in BTS_Tests. This makes sure the files are always properly updated even if something goes wrong (such as docker kill failing to stop hnbgw because it exited earlier due to unsupported feature). Change-Id: Iac3bd9cf3448e18930dcef6c9ae4b6530939ffe6
